4 held for fraud in railway recruitment exam
Four persons have been arrested with large quantities of high-tech devices meant to be used for cheating in Railway recruitment examination scheduled  on Sunday police said.

Acting on a tip off, the Special Task Force (STF) teams raided various places in Patna last night and arrested the four accused on charges of planning to commit fraud and cheating using high-tech bluetooth devices in the Group ''D'' examination under railway recruitment cell of the East-Central Railway (ECR), IG (Operations) Amit Kumar said.

The accused have been identified as Rajkumar Singh, Dinkar Pandey, Ajit Kumar and Varun Kumar.

A haul of high-tech equipments and other materials like bluetooth device, ear piece, mobile phones, sim card, micro battery, original certificates, admit cards, besides Rs 55,000 cash and a motorcycle have been seized from them, Kumar said.
